Output 751608281f28fbe86f32dfe89879870c09d44cd317e360347b307aa464d8313a:1
- value
- 593460
- script pubkey
- OP_0 OP_PUSHBYTES_20 b7edc3caa7d1c643e541060d9ce18c22bc399edb
- address
- bc1qklku8j4868ry8e2pqcxeecvvy27rn8kmmww8wd
- transaction
- 751608281f28fbe86f32dfe89879870c09d44cd317e360347b307aa464d8313a